Worldcom PR Group Partner Stefan Pollack recently provided his insights on The Biggest Challenges for PR in 2026. The first topic on the list was the impact of AI on the public relations industry.

He outlines 2026 as the year the PR industry moves from storytelling to story stewardship. The job of Public Relations will be to manage truth, technology and trust all at once.  However, PR will need to apply the same creativity that once defined advertising and the same integrity that once defined journalism.

“The biggest challenge for public relations in 2026 will be managing truth at machine speed,” Pollack Said. “Artificial intelligence will flood the ecosystem with faster, cheaper and often more persuasive forms of misinformation.”

His article covered a multitude of topics including:

  • How AI will Support and Transform PR
  • Video and Audio Content Changes
  • Combatting Misinformation and Disinformation
  • Thought Leadership in a Fragmented Media Landscape
  • Leveraging In-person Events

Throughout the article, there is a theme that =in a world where almost anything can be simulated, developing a real connection is now more valuable and strategic.

PR will no longer sit at the end of the communications chain; it will become the connective tissue between data, emotion and action. And that’s not just a prediction. That’s where we’re already heading.
